QUARTERLY PLANNING NOTE — Annual Billing Transition

Sales leads: beginning next quarter, the Brightmoor platform moves to annual billing as the default for new contracts. Monthly terms remain available only with regional director approval. Pricing sheets are being updated; quota credit rules will follow separately. Please hold customer announcements until the collateral ships. The underlying rationale is set out immediately below.

management briefing: Casvanek Logistics plans to lower the Druox list price by 49.1 percent in April. The board signed off on a budget of $16.5 million for Project Rusath. The renewal with Kasvanix Partners closes at $67.9 million a year, 33.9 percent above the last contract. Project Casath slips by one quarter because of the staffing delay.

## Authentication

Welcome aboard! Before you can run the fd-hunter tooling against the Copperline fleet, you'll need access to the introspection API — that's what lets the scanner snapshot open file descriptors on each pod without SSH. Don't use your personal token for batch runs; it'll get rate-limited and your hunt will stall halfway. Instead, grab the shared scanner key from below, export it as an env var, and you're set. Here's the key.

service key, yadug-bajog: zpat3_pou

Environment variables — Gridloom crossword generator. All config lives in .env, loaded at boot. WORDLIST_PATH points to the curated lexicon. MAX_GRID_SIZE caps puzzle dimensions; keep it at 21 for dailies. SOLVER_THREADS defaults to 4. The clue-suggestion service requires an API credential, rotated monthly by the Tarnwell infra team. That credential is set on the line immediately below.

sealed setting: ARCHIVE_KEY3=8d0